Gananda, Newark take FL Swimming and Diving League titles

The Finger Lakes Swimming and Diving season came to a close this weekend for 2024. Two team champions were crowned across two divisions. The Newark Reds won Division One with a score of 351. The Gananda Blue Panthers took the title in Division Two with a score of 337. Check out the full results and awards below as well as the Sectional Tournament schedule.


Division One

  1. Newark/Lyons: 352
  2. Palmyra-Macedon: 257
  3. Geneva: 212
  4. North Rose-Wolcott: 168
  5. Sodus: 154

Division Two

  1. Gananda: 337
  2. Naples: 291
  3. Marcus Whitman: 213
  4. Midlakes: 168
  5. Clyde-Savannah: 101

Outstanding Senior Swimmer (co-winners): JT Humiston (Geneva), Brendan Laity (Marcus Whitman)

Outstanding Performer of the Meet: George Newsome (Pal-Mac)

  • Newsome qualified for the State meet in the 500 Freestyle with a time of 4:52.48

Coach of the Year (co-winners): Alinda Gangi (Naples), Jeff Garrett (Newark/Lyons)

Double Individual Event Winners:

  • George Newsome (Pal-Mac D1): 200 Individual Medley and 500 Freestyle
  • Matthew Ingersoll (North Rose-Wolcott D1): 50 Freestyle and 100 Freestyle
  • Brendan Laity (Marcus Whitman D2): 200 Freestyle and 500 Freestyle
  • Peyton Conner (Gananda D2): 50 Freestyle and 100 Butterfly
  • Cohen Kelley (Gananda D2): 200 Individual Medley and 100 Breaststroke

Relay Competition Results:

  • Division 1- Newark/Lyons: 200 Medley
  • Division 1- Pal-Mac: 200 Freestyle and 400 Freestyle
  • Division 2- Gananda: 200 Medley, 200 Freestyle, and 400 Freestyle
